The nurse should obtain a maternal serum alpha-fetoprotein (MSAFP) specimen for a client at 12 weeks of gestation.
MSAFP is a screening tool used to identify fetal neural tube defects (NTDs) such as spina bifida and anencephaly.
Elevated levels of MSAFP indicate an increased risk for NTDs, while low levels indicate an increased risk for chromosomal abnormalities such as Down syndrome.
Administering rubella vaccine (A) is contraindicated during pregnancy as it is a live vaccine and can cause fetal harm.

The Babinski reflex, also known as the plantar reflex, is a normal reflex in infants
that occurs when the sole of the foot is stroked from heel to toe.

In response to this stimulus, the big toe moves upward or toward the top surface of the foot and the other toes fan out.
